My Current Skincare Routine.

I have recently been really into my skincare so I thought I would do a post on it. I have pretty normal to dry skin with very few breakouts, I do however suffer from blocked pores. Ever since I have been doing this routine I have far fewer clogged pores and virtually no blackheads. It’s pretty time consuming but I love doing it as I find it relaxing after a hard day’s work.

Morning Step 1: I am always in a rush in the morning so I will just quickly freshen my face with a Simple wipe.


Morning Step 2: I apply a good layer of Oilatum Natural Repair Face Cream. I find this is excellent under foundation, it keeps my skin looking radiant all day.




Morning Step 3: Makeup!

Evening Step 1: I use the Superdrug Hot Cloth Cleanser and the muslin cloth that it comes with. I LOVE this cleanser. It gets rid of any flaky skin and cleanses deeply into pores. I love the creamy consistency and it smells really indulgent.



Evening Step 2: I use the Body Shop Aloe Toner to make sure that any trace of cleanser is removed and to get my skin ready for moisture. This toner isn’t drying at all because it doesn’t contain any alcohol, it never irritates my skin.



Evening Step 3: A thin layer of Superdrug Optimum Swiss Apple Serum. I find this makes my skin appear fresher and more radiant in the mornings. It feels really nurturing and smells lovely and fresh. This is a must for me in the winter because I get extremely dry patches, this keeps them at bay.



Evening Step 4: Superdrug Natural High Eye Cream. I have no other reason to use this other than I like it. It does keep my eyes feel comfortable and moisturised, plus I have noticed an improvement in my dark circles.



Evening Step 5: I use my Oilatum again. I will never use anything else I don’t think. Even better than my Embryolisse and Clinique Dramatically Different face creams.



That’s pretty much my daily skin care routine. I also use a facial peel by Soap & Glory once a week for a deeper exfoliation. The Fab Pore Facial Peel. This contains Salicylic acid which allows the dead skin cells to properly detach and reveal brighter fresher looking skin.
